Abstract |
Morphological analysis is an important step in natural language processing and its various applications. Each kind of these applications needs a certain balance between: performance, accuracy, and generality of solutions (i.e. getting all possible roots); while we focus on performance with a ―good accuracy in Information retrieval applications, we try to achieve high accuracy in systems like pos-tagger and machine translation, and both high accuracy and high generality in systems like language learning systems and Arabic lexical dictionaries. In this paper, we describe our approach to build a flexible and application oriented Arabic morphological analyzer; this approach is designed to satisfy various requirements of most applications which need morphological processing. It also provides a separate stage (Original Letters Detection Algorithm) which can be plugged easily in any Other morphological analyzer to improve its performance, and with no negative effect on its reliability.
